At McKesson, we’re all about delivering better health — making sure patients get the medications they need, safely and on time. As Sr. Manager, Pharmacy Distribution Operations, you’ll manage the day-to-day operations of one of our high-volume, automated pharmaceutical distribution centers within the Central Fill Pharmacy network. This is a customer co-located role — you’ll be based on-site with our customer as the face of McKesson, owning the day-to-day relationship and serving as their trusted operational partner. You’ll direct supervisors, leads, and individual contributors to deliver excellence in safety, quality, service, and cost, applying operational policies to establish and achieve department goals. You’ll also partner directly with the customer to set strategy and align our operations to achieve their goals — helping shape a culture of continuous improvement, team engagement, and patient-first thinking while running daily operations, streamlining workflows, and collaborating across cross‑functional teams to help us deliver on our mission.
